Molecular Formula C30H43NO2
Molecular Weight 449.70 g/mol
Exact Mass 449.329379614 g/mol
Topological Polar Surface Area (TPSA) 53.10 Ų
XlogP 7.20
Atomic LogP (AlogP) 7.21
H-Bond Acceptor 2
H-Bond Donor 2
Rotatable Bonds 3
